Output 8e787809cfaf6f5090dc75a21f2a0178eb45c8fdd02faa7440eb27cf9bcfbb7b:0

value
3883896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e85d8e4bab2a77438dc75837efa6f4458a9402 OP_EQUAL
address
3B59D9NVtipbVJYvvwRRDSzz8HExBxuJqt
transaction
8e787809cfaf6f5090dc75a21f2a0178eb45c8fdd02faa7440eb27cf9bcfbb7b
spent
true